Aidan Hutchinson, the Detroit Lions' star defensive end, has been fully cleared to return to football after undergoing rehabilitation from a severe leg injury suffered in the 2024 season. Expressing his enthusiasm, Hutchinson reflected on the psychological and physical hurdles he overcame during recovery, stating he is now ready to rejoin his teammates. He mentioned the emotional challenges of feeling disconnected while injured but emphasized the support he received through faith. Hutchinson is looking forward to the upcoming season and is eager to participate in voluntary workouts, describing this time away from the game as the longest hiatus of his career.
In those moments, you try to look at all the silver linings that you can in order to make it make sense a little bit and still, at the end of the day, you're still questioning, 'why?'. That's why you dive into faith and that's kind of what I did and it was a very challenging time for a few months.
I'm really looking forward to the season. I think this is the most excited I've been for OTAs in my life. This is the biggest hiatus I've had without playing ball, so I'm pumped.
